Dead rat in mid-day meal creates panic in Bihar
Patna: Panic spread among students in Bihar's Saran district after a dead rat was found in a mid-day meal, school officials said on Friday.

Dozens of students were stunned when a dead rat was found in a mid-day meal at the Chandrashekhar Azad Middle School in Saran district, about 80 km from here.

"Some students cried loudly after a dead rat was found in a midday meal in the school on Thursday afternoon and soon it created panic among hundreds of students," a teacher said.

After that most of the students refused to consume the mid-day meal served to them.

Hundreds of villagers also gathered as the news about the dead rat spread. "Angry villagers demanded action against an NGO, which is in charge of distributing the mid-day meal in the school," an official said.

The school headmaster Surendra Prasad Singh said that he had informed the district Education Officer about the incident and will order a probe.

A few months ago, a lizard was found in the mid-day meal that angered students and their parents.

The mid-day meal scheme has reported widespread corruption as poor quality food is served to the children and government guidelines are ignored. IANS
